Le sous-système haptique Android fait référence aux fonctionnalités matérielles et logicielles qui contribuent à la création de stimuli via le sens du toucher. La création d'effets haptiques nécessite un degré élevé de dépendances matérielles, tandis que la perception des stimuli haptiques nécessite un degré élevé de dépendances et de préférences utilisateur. Cette dichotomie met les fabricants d'appareils au défi de développer et de maximiser les avantages haptiques pour les utilisateurs dans l'écosystème Android.
L'implémentation correcte des effets haptiques nécessite un matériel compatible et à jour. Pour que les utilisateurs perçoivent correctement les stimuli haptiques, des préférences spécifiques doivent être modifiées afin de créer les effets souhaités. Les fabricants doivent remplir ces deux conditions pour implémenter correctement la technologie haptique sur Android.
Les guides suivants décrivent les instructions de conformité pour les fabricants d'appareils et les développeurs d'applications, et fournissent des conseils clairs pour utiliser au mieux les API haptiques Android:
Checklist détaillée détaillant la conformité logicielle et matérielle haptique
Cette checklist vous guide à travers les éléments clés du processus de configuration matérielle.
-
Voici la liste des principes d'expérience utilisateur qui sous-tendent les améliorations haptiques d'Android.
Présentation détaillée des principes d'UX et de conception
Ces principes illustrent l'importance de la conformité matérielle pour améliorer l'expérience haptique des utilisateurs finaux Android.
-
Découvrez comment évaluer l'implémentation des effets haptiques avec l'équipement de test nécessaire et appliquer vos résultats à la carte des performances pour tirer des conclusions sur les performances de votre appareil en cours de test.
Pour en savoir plus sur la compatibilité en général, consultez le document de définition de compatibilité Android.
Pour en savoir plus sur l'utilisation du retour haptique dans Android, consultez la documentation pour les développeurs Android.